What Is Responsive Design

Adaptive Web Design or Responsive Design is a web design technique. Currently, Responsive Design is used to have a web page that adapts well to the measurements of the different screens of each type of device (smartphones, tablets, and computers)

When a website can adapt to the different sizes that exist, we speak of a multiplatform website. A series of CSS3 style sheets are needed using the “media query” attribute to convert an ordinary website into a multiplatform. Thanks to a multiplatform website, the user experience is more enjoyable and meets their needs. From smartphones, the websites where you had to expand to read something are becoming outdated.

Why Should Your Website Be “Responsive”

Next, we will explain to you why your website should be responsive through the main advantages of Responsive Design. The advantages are many and, at the same time, of great relevance if you have a website or plan to dedicate yourself to creating websites.

  • Better user experience. By applying Responsive Design, the user experience is improved. Therefore, the time spent on the web will improve, the bounce rate between pages will increase, and, in turn, your brand image will improve. Therefore, users will enjoy greater ease and practicality when browsing your website, so they will also have a better opinion of it.
  • End of duplicate content. When you use a mobile version to offer content adapted to users who access your website, duplicate content is created. Google penalizes duplicate content, so using a mobile version is very detrimental to your website’s SEO. Thanks to an Adaptive Web Design, you avoid this problem since instead of duplicating the content of a page, the content itself is organized differently depending on the device with which the web is accessed.
  • Web cost reduction. Applying responsive Design, a website’s development and maintenance costs are reduced since the same template is used for the different devices or platforms. Therefore, a single change takes effect in all versions.
